Demystifying Deep Learning: A Glimpse into the AI Future
Deep learning, a aspect of machine learning, has emerged as a transformative phenomenon in recent years. It involves conditioning artificial neural networks with vast amounts of data, here enabling them to acquire complex patterns and produce intelligent decisions. This powerful capability has enabled a revolution across diverse industries, from manufacturing to transportation.
As deep learning continues, it promises to transform our world in unprecedented ways. Imagine applications such as self-driving vehicles, personalized medicine, and ubiquitous AI assistants that enhance human capabilities.
- Nevertheless, there are concerns associated with deep learning, such as the need for massive datasets, societal impacts, and the risk of bias in algorithms.
Tackling these challenges is crucial to ensuring that deep learning is used ethically for the benefit of humanity.

Artificial intelligence has rapidly evolved into an integral part of modern life, revolutionizing industries from healthcare to finance. However, this swift advancement raises profound ethical dilemmas. One of the primary debates is whether AI ultimately serves as a benefactor or a potential threat.
- Algorithmic bias can perpetuate and amplify existing societal divisions, leading to prejudiced decisions.
- Automation's Impact on Employment is a urgent concern as AI systems take over tasks, potentially leading to unemployment.
- Privacy violations are another crucial issue as AI relies on vast amounts of user information, raising questions about surveillance, manipulation, and misuse.
Confronting these ethical challenges requires a multifaceted approach involving collaboration between technological innovators, social scientists, and legal experts.
